Comprehending the Swiss Driving License System

Before going over the process of acquiring a driving license, it's vital to understand the structure surrounding Swiss driving licenses. In Switzerland, the driving license is classified into different classes depending upon the type of lorry one means to operate. Below is a summary of the main categories:

CategoryCar TypeMinimum Age
AMotorcycles18 years
BCars18 years
CTrucks21 years
DBuses21 years
BEVehicles with a trailer18 years
C1Light trucks18 years
C1ELight trucks with a trailer18 years
D1Buses with less than 9 passengers21 years

For those seeking to obtain a Swiss driving license legitimately, the procedure is well-defined, albeit somewhat requiring. Here are the actions to follow:

1. Check Eligibility

  • Need to be a homeowner of Switzerland.
  • Must satisfy the minimum age requirement for the preferred classification.

2. Complete the Required Training

  • Enroll in a certified driving school.
  • Complete theoretical and practical lessons.

3. Pass the Theory Test

  • After completing your training, you will need to take a theory test.
  • The test normally includes multiple-choice concerns regarding traffic rules and road indications.

4. Pass the Practical Driving Test

  • Schedule and pass a useful driving test conducted by a certified inspector.

5. Send Your Application

  • Send your application together with the required documents to your local car licensing workplace.
  • Required files generally include identification, residency proof, and test certificates.

6. Receive Your License

  • If your application is authorized, you will receive your Swiss driving license by mail.

Typical Costs Involved

The costs related to getting a Swiss driving license can vary depending upon a number of elements, including the driving school picked, but here's an overview:

Cost ItemEstimated Cost (CHF)
Driving School Course1,500 - 2,500
Theory Test Fee30 - 50
Practical Test Fee100 - 200
Application Fee50 - 100
Overall Estimated Cost1,680 - 2,850

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Can I utilize a foreign driving license in Switzerland?

  • Yes, however just for a limited time. Travelers can drive with their foreign license for as much as one year. After that, you need to obtain a Swiss driving license.

2. Is it possible to convert my driving license from another country to a Swiss one?

  • Yes, depending on your nation of origin. Some nations have arrangements with Switzerland permitting a simple conversion without additional tests.

3. What if I fail the driving test?

  • You can retake the test after a waiting duration. The number of efforts is typically endless, but fees make an application for each effort.

4. The length of time does it require to get a Swiss driving license?

  • The time frame differs, however you can anticipate the procedure to take anywhere from a few weeks to a number of months, depending on private situations and scheduling.
